L-Shaped, U-Shaped, and Island Walk-In Layouts
A proper choice of configuration will determine the way your closet will perform:
- L-shaped: Ideal for corner spaces, offering clear division between sections
- U-shaped: Wraps around three walls for maximum storage and immersive design
- Island-centric: Features a centerpiece for folding, storage, or seating—best for large walk-ins
Both layouts promote navigation and flow. Islands provide extra luxury and utility whereas L and U-shape make use of wall space and create zoning of hanging items, shoes and drawers.
Closet Cabinets, Drawers, and Open Shelving Ideas
An ideal closet system for walk-in closets storage facility has a combination of both hidden and open storage:
- Drawer stacks: Tuck away undergarments, folded tees, and seasonal pieces
- Cabinetry with doors: Protect delicate or off-season items from dust
- Open shelving: Keep frequently used items accessible and styled
Pro tip: Install strip LED lighting under shelves or in drawers to increase both utility and atmosphere.
Small Walk-In Closet Ideas with Maximum Utility
The lack of space does not imply the lack of style. To make small closet systems for walk-in closets seem large use:
- Floor-to-ceiling vertical storage to make use of height
- Sliding or mirrored doors to conserve space and add depth
- Pull-out accessory drawers or rotating racks to access more in less space
- Neutral palettes and uniform hardware for a sleek, modern finish
Even small closets can be luxurious and custom-made with clever design decisions.

Custom Closet Systems Installation Timeline
Most closet systems for walk-in closets installation have a path that goes from your initial consultation to the polishing of the final hardware:
| Stage | Timeline Estimate |
|---|---|
| Initial consultation | 1–2 days |
| Design + revisions | 1–2 weeks |
| Material ordering & prep | 2–4 weeks (varies) |
| Installation | 1–3 days |

2. Can walk-in closets be designed for small spaces?
Absolutely! Vertical storage, a mirrored interior and clever zoning can make small closet systems for walk-in closets surprisingly spacious. Light-colored finishes, pull-out drawers, and floating shelves maximize space in terms of both appearance and functionality.

4. Are walk-in closet cabinets adjustable?
Yes, most of the parts such as shelves, hanging rods and even drawers can be adjusted in height. This flexibility enables you to change the layout as time goes by according to your needs. That is one of the main benefits of having a professional custom closet systems for walk-in closets company.
